LGC is a leading global life science tools company providing mission‑critical components and solutions in high‑growth application areas across the human healthcare and applied market segments. Its product portfolio includes genomic analysis and quality‑assurance tools known for performance, quality, and versatility.

We are looking for an ambitious and highly capable IFS Solution Architect to join our engineering team. The role involves revamping our ERP systems and guiding future technological growth, ensuring that technical solutions align with business needs through discovery meetings, peer reviews, and collaboration with technical and functional teams.

  • Solution Build & Alignment
    • Lead and engage in discovery meetings to ensure business requirements are aligned with proposed application solutions.
    • Build solutions that reflect the diversity of the LGC Group, maintaining ease of upkeep and reuse of current features.
    • Apply a unitary approach to avoid duplication and promote consistency.
  • Development & Review
    • Complete peer reviews of development specifications.
    • Collaborate closely with the Technical Team to evaluate viability of proposed solutions.
  • Change & Project Support
    • Assist the Change Request process and project completion in both IFS Apps9 and IFS Cloud.
    • Remain aligned with the IFS Cloud solution strategy and build LGC’s approach accordingly.
    • Continue supporting IFS Apps9 until fully phased out, while facilitating IFS Cloud deployment.
  • Knowledge & Training
    • Train the ERP team on managing Solution objects to ensure the Solution Definition reflects actual business usage.
    • Provide mentorship and support to functional analysts, including training in tools and methodologies.
  • Documentation & Quality
    • Develop and maintain documentation mechanisms for IFS and ancillary systems to meet validated process requirements.
    • Use and improve tools to support Quality processes and ensure compliance with GxP and ISO standards.
  • Governance & Control
    • Establish and manage Solution Baseline Management for IFS Cloud:
    • Identify and control IFS Configuration objects.
    • Manage changes to the configuration baseline.
    • Coordinate LGC process mapping using 2c8.
  • Collaborator Engagement
    • Act as a representative of the business and ERP team in interactions with third parties.
    • Keep up to date on all current and planned applications of ERP tools within both IFS Apps9 and IFS Cloud environments.
